Rann of Kutch — The White Rann

The White Rann is a vast seasonal salt marsh that turns into a dazzling white expanse once the monsoon water evaporates. Stretching to the horizon, it is one of the most surreal landscapes in India, especially magical at sunset and under a full moon.

Every winter, the White Rann becomes home to the famous Rann Utsav — a festival of Kutchi culture, music, dance and craft held near Dhordo, not far from Hodka. Staying with us puts you within easy reach of both the Rann Utsav festival grounds and the open salt desert.

Best Time to Visit

Sunset and moonlit nights during the Rann Utsav season (November to February) offer the most spectacular views.
